The Thermae Bath Spa is Bath’s original and only natural thermal spa. My plan is to buy the 4 hour spa session. They also have a cafe & restaurant and a visitor center.

There is a great deal of history in the water and there are some archival films and photos available for viewing if you click on the link above. I have read that the water that is generated in these spas is anywhere from 6,000 to 10,000 years old! Can you wrap your brain around that??? I’m having a hard time doing that myself!
